Senior Mobile Application Developer

1 day ago


Manama, Manama, Bahrain beBeeDeveloper Full time 6,000 - 12,000
Mobile Application Developer

We are seeking a skilled iPhone mobile application developer who can think creatively and push the limits of innovation. The ideal candidate is passionate about mobile apps for the iOS platform and has a strong portfolio to showcase their skills.

You will be involved in every stage of the development process, from conceptualizing product ideas to delivering high-quality applications. You will also contribute to our existing portfolio of mobile apps and ensure they continue to function flawlessly across new iOS releases.

Job Specifications
  • A minimum of 3 years of experience in iOS development.
  • A Bachelor's or Master's degree in Computer Science, Engineering, or a related field.
  • Exceptional organizational and project management skills.
  • Demonstrated success in defining and launching mobile applications.
  • Design and build advanced applications for the iOS platform.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Unit-test code for robustness, including edge cases, usability, and general reliability.
  • Work on bug fixing and improving application performance.
  • Continuously discover, evaluate, and implement new technologies to maximize development efficiency.
  • A deep familiarity with Objective-C and Cocoa Touch.
  • Experience working with iOS frameworks such as Core Data, Core Animation, Core Graphics, and Core Text.
  • Experience with third-party libraries and Social APIs.
  • A solid understanding of the full mobile development life cycle.
  • Experience in web services integration (JSON, XML).
  • Experience with Swift language.
  • Experience in payment gateway integration (e.g. Braintree, Stripe) for credit card & PayPal.

The Ideal Candidate

We are looking for a highly motivated and talented individual who is passionate about mobile app development. If you have a strong portfolio, excellent coding skills, and a desire to innovate, we encourage you to apply.

Please submit your resume, cover letter, and a link to your portfolio for consideration.



  • Manama, Manama, Bahrain beBeeAndroid Full time

    Job DescriptionAs a Senior Android Engineer, you will play a key role in designing, developing and optimizing high-quality Android applications. Your expertise will shape the future of mobile solutions providing exceptional user experiences.Collaborate with cross-functional teams to translate business requirements into technical specifications and deliver...


  • Manama, Manama, Bahrain beBeeDevelopment Full time 8,000 - 10,000

    Job TitleSenior iOS Developer NeededWe are seeking a skilled and experienced iOS developer to join our team. As a Senior iOS Developer, you will be responsible for designing and developing advanced applications for the iOS platform.You will be involved in every step of the development process, from brainstorming product ideas to pushing apps out the door....


  • Manama, Manama, Bahrain beBeeAndroidDeveloper Full time 60,000 - 100,000

    Unlock Your Android Development PotentialWe're on the hunt for a talented and ambitious Android application developer who can push the boundaries of innovation. If you're passionate about crafting engaging mobile experiences for the Android platform and have a portfolio that showcases your expertise, we want to hear from you.As a key member of our...


  • Manama, Manama, Bahrain beBeeDigitalOperations Full time 90,000 - 120,000

    Job DescriptionAs a Digital Operations Project Manager, you will play a key role in the success of our company. You will oversee the development lifecycle of our mobile app, ensuring that all project objectives and milestones are clearly defined and met.You will serve as the primary liaison between business stakeholders and the technical development team,...


  • Manama, Manama, Bahrain beBeeAnalysis Full time

    Lead Applications DeveloperThe Applications Development Lead is a senior level position responsible for establishing and implementing new or revised application systems and programs in coordination with the Technology team. The overall objective of this role is to lead applications systems analysis and programming activities.Responsibilities:


  • Manama, Manama, Bahrain Citi Full time

    Join or sign in to find your next jobJoin to apply for the Applications Development Lead Analyst role at CitiJoin to apply for the Applications Development Lead Analyst role at CitiThe Applications Development Technology Lead Analyst is a senior level position responsible for establishing and implementing new or revised application systems and programs in...


  • Manama, Manama, Bahrain Citi Full time

    Join or sign in to find your next jobJoin to apply for the Applications Development Lead Analyst role at CitiJoin to apply for the Applications Development Lead Analyst role at CitiThe Applications Development Technology Lead Analyst is a senior level position responsible for establishing and implementing new or revised application systems and programs in...


  • Manama, Manama, Bahrain SWATX Full time

    As a Senior Android Engineer at SWATX, you will play a key role in designing, developing, and optimizing high-quality Android applications. Your expertise will help shape the future of our mobile solutions, providing exceptional user experiences. Collaborate with cross-functional teams to translate business requirements into technical specifications and...


  • Manama, Manama, Bahrain beBeeBanking Full time 8,000 - 12,000

    About This RoleWe are seeking an experienced Outsystems Developer- Banking to join our team in Bahrain. The successful candidate will be responsible for a range of tasks including mobile and web development using Outsystems, API integration and development, database SQL development and integration, and reviewing technical service requests.

  • Outsystems Developer

    3 weeks ago


    Manama, Manama, Bahrain RESO Full time

    Job DescriptionVAM Systems is currently looking for Outsystems Developer for our Bahrain operations with the following skillsets and terms & conditions:Years of Experience: 4-6 YearsQualificationBA Computer SciencePreferred Previous Work Experience: BankingTechnology Tools Required : Outsystems, MS SQL, HTML, CSS, ReactiveExperience Required:Knowledge of...